The Sumac Solar project is a proposed 80 MW solar generation facility located in Bertie County, North Carolina. The project is being developed within the Dominion service area and has appeared in recent news coverage. It is listed in the PJM interconnection queue as entry AD1-022, with a queue entry date of June 19, 2017, and a proposed commercial operation date of July 1, 2028.
The Sumac Solar project's interconnection agreement (IA) has been executed. The point of interconnection (POI) is the Cashie-Trowbridge 230 kV line.
